BS in Financial Technology Curriculum

Graduation with a BS in Financial Technology requires that the student complete 122 credits.

Code Title Credits
Business Core Curriculum 43
Complete the Business Core Cirruculum  
University Curriculum 34
Complete the University Curriculum for the School of Business  
Financial Technology Core 21
FIN 301 Introduction to FinTech 3
CIS 245 Programming with Python 3
FIN 310 Investment Analysis 3
FIN 320 Financial Modeling 3
FIN 325 Financial Analytics Using Python 3
FIN 331 OR CIS 371 Decentralized Finance OR Introduction to Blockchain Technology for Business 3
FIN 425 Advanced Financial Analytics 3
Financial Technology Electives 9
Students must complete 9 credits of financial technology electives  
BAN 220 Data Mining for Business Insights 3
BAN 420 Machine Learning and AI For Business 3
CIS 350 Data Analysis / Excel 3
DS 300 Tools for Data Science 3
DS 399 Applied time Series Analysis and Forecasting 3
DS 380 Data Mining 3
DS 385 Machine Learning 3
EC 365 Econometrics 3
FIN 440 Fixed Income Analytics 3
FIN 450 Applied Portfolio Management 3
FIN 470 Trading Strategies and Practices 3
FIN 485 Derivatives 3
Open Electives 15
Students must complete 15 credits of open electives. This curriculum leaves room for financial technology majors to minor in computer science. Related courses e.g. JRN 488: The International Money Trail can taken as open electives.  
Total Credits 122
